During my first few years of college, I worked weekends at a Toy store, and every week the store ran the Wizards of the Coast sanctioned Pokemon Trading Card League... and I was and thier "Gym Leader" (Per wizards documentation... you actually had to send them your info, fill out paperwork, and show you had at least a working knowledge of the game).

Of course, it was probably one of the most fun parts of the job... it beat the heck out of running the register.

It was great to see all the kids come in and play with all of the other kids... and it was even better when you saw kids that were getting stomped on go back an win some games after coming up to me and asking why they kept losing (sometimes in near tears... these were 6-12 year olds.) I would sit down with the kids, and help them fine tune thier decks, and if they were old enough, it try to explain more complex ideas like probability, statistics and the importance of card advantage.
